Output 65d30f94e434053ecafb64bc060140098bbd0cbaa2207cfe9fe027611e634638:3

value
44721405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ef206dfcc5aaf787633356c66677de28d5917327 OP_EQUAL
address
3PVQGeBuvmoPcWq7MvaTCVnB1cwhjaJNdV
transaction
65d30f94e434053ecafb64bc060140098bbd0cbaa2207cfe9fe027611e634638
spent
true